Utilisateur:Omondi/common.css

De Wikivoyage

Note : après avoir publié vos modifications, il se peut que vous deviez forcer le rechargement complet du cache de votre navigateur pour voir les changements.

  • Firefox / Safari : maintenez la touche Maj (Shift) en cliquant sur le bouton Actualiser ou appuyez sur Ctrl + F5 ou Ctrl + R (⌘ + R sur un Mac).
  • Google Chrome : appuyez sur Ctrl + Maj + R (⌘ + Shift + R sur un Mac).
  • Internet Explorer / Edge : maintenez la touche Ctrl en cliquant sur le bouton Actualiser ou pressez Ctrl + F5.
  • Opera : appuyez sur Ctrl + F5.
/* Classes pour les colonnes des portails */
.portail-gauche,
.portail-droite {
	box-sizing: border-box;
}
.portail-gauche {
	float: left;
	padding-right: 1.2rem;
}
.portail-droite {
	float: right;
}
@media (max-width: 981px) {
	.portail-gauche,
	.portail-droite {
		float: none;
		width: auto !important;
	}
	.portail-gauche {
		padding-right: 0;
	}
}

#portail_contenu {
	margin-top: 1rem;
}
#portail_contenu .portail-gauche {
	width: 60%;
}
#portail_contenu .portail-droite {
	width: 40%;
}
#portail_contenu:after {
	clear: both;
	display: table;
	content: '';
}

.portail_cadre {
	box-shadow: 0 0 0.3rem #999;
	border-radius: 0.2rem;
	padding: 1.2rem;
	margin-bottom: 1.6rem;
}
/* S'assurer que ces règles emportent bien la priorité sur toutes les skins */
#mw-content-text .portail_cadre h2 {
	font-variant: small-caps;
	letter-spacing: 0.01em;
	border-bottom: solid 0.2rem #bdd8fb;
	margin: -0.4rem 0 0.5rem;
}

@media (min-width: 982px) {
	#portail_contenu {
		display: flex;
	}
	#portail_contenu .portail-gauche,
	#portail_contenu .portail-droite {
		display: flex;
		flex-direction: column;
	}
	.portail_cadre:nth-child(1) {
		flex-grow: 1;
	}
	.portail_cadre:nth-child(2) {
		flex-grow: 2;
	}
	.portail_cadre:nth-child(3) {
		flex-grow: 3;
	}
}

/* Page d'accueil et portail utilisant la même structure */
.accueil-contenu {
	margin: 0.4em -1% 0.4em 0;
	display: flex;
	flex-flow: wrap;
	overflow: hidden; /*be kind ie10 et les navigateurs ne gérant pas les flexbox */
}
.accueil-droite,
.accueil-gauche {
	display: flex;
	flex-flow: wrap;
	align-content: flex-start;
	margin: 0.4em 1% 0.4em 0;
	border: 1px solid #a7d7f9;
	border-radius: 1em;
}
.accueil-droite {
	background: #f5faff;
	flex: 21em;
	overflow: hidden;/*ie10*/
}
.accueil-gauche {
	flex: 2 35em;
	float: left; /*ie10*/
	width: 64%; /*ie10*/
}
.accueil-cadre {
	padding: 1.2em;
}
.accueil-cadre .mw-headline-number {
	display: none;
}

/* Retire le nom de la page d'accueil */
body.action-view.page-Accueil #firstHeading {
	position: absolute;
	top: -5000px;
}

/* Mise en page Accueil */

#accueil_en-tete {
	background: linear-gradient(to bottom, #fff, #e8f2f8);
	border-bottom: solid 1px #a8d7fc;
}
#accueil_bandeau {
	background: url("//upload.wikimedia.org/wikipedia/commons/d/d1/Wikivoyage-Logo-v3-en.svg") no-repeat 50px 1px;
	background-size: 100px 100px;
	padding: 1.5rem 1rem 1rem;
	font-family: 'Open Sans', Sans-serif;
}
#accueil_bloc-titre {
	display: inline-block;
	margin-left: 14rem;
	margin-bottom: 1rem;
	text-align: left;
	line-height: 1.6;
	color: #457;
}
#accueil_bloc-titre > h2 {
	margin: 0;
	padding: 0;
	border: none;
	font-size: 200%;
	font-weight: bold;
	font-family: 'Open Sans', Sans-serif;
	color: #457;
}
#accueil_bloc-titre > p {
	margin: 0;
	padding: 0;
	font-size: 95%;
}
#accueil_bloc-liens {
	text-align: center;
	font-size: 90%;
	font-weight: bold;
}
#accueil_lien-mobile {
	margin-bottom: 1rem;
}

#accueil_contenu {
	margin-top: 1rem;
}
#accueil_contenu .portail-gauche {
	width: 60%;
}
#accueil_contenu .portail-droite {
	width: 40%;
}
#accueil_contenu:after {
	clear: both;
	display: table;
	content: '';
}

.accueil_cadre {
	border-radius: 0.2rem;
	padding: 1.2rem;
	margin-bottom: 1.6rem;
}
/* Light blue */
#content .color1 {
 box-shadow: 0 0 0.3rem #6cc8f3;
}
/* Light green */
#content .color2 {
 box-shadow: 0 0 0.3rem #80f000;
}
 
/* Dark green */
#content .color3 {
 box-shadow: 0 0 0.3rem #158200;
}
 
/* Orange */
#content .color4 {
 box-shadow: 0 0 0.3rem #EDAA02;
}
 
/* Red */
#content .color5 {
 box-shadow: 0 0 0.3rem #DB0003;
}
 
/* Brown */
#content .color6 {
 box-shadow: 0 0 0.3rem #AD5A1B;
}
 
/* Violet */
#content .color7 {
 box-shadow: 0 0 0.3rem #9154AD;
}
 
/* Black */
#content .color8 {
 box-shadow: 0 0 0.3rem #000000;
}
 
/* Dark blue */
#content .color9 {
 box-shadow: 0 0 0.3rem #0400FF;

}
/* S'assurer que ces règles emportent bien la priorité sur toutes les skins */
#mw-content-text .accueil_cadre h2 {
	font-variant: small-caps;
	letter-spacing: 0.01em;
	margin: -0.4rem 0 0.5rem;
}

.accueil_pied {
	margin-top: 1.8em;
	font-size: 85%;
	text-align: right;
}

@media (min-width: 982px) {
	#accueil_contenu {
		display: flex;
	}
	#accueil_contenu .portail-gauche,
	#accueil_contenu .portail-droite {
		display: flex;
		flex-direction: column;
	}
	.accueil_cadre:nth-child(1) {
		flex-grow: 1;
	}
	.accueil_cadre:nth-child(2) {
		flex-grow: 2;
	}
	.accueil_cadre:nth-child(3) {
		flex-grow: 3;
	}
}

/* Classe pour les listes horizontales séparées par des puces.
   Adaptation de la classe 'hlist' de en:User:Edokter.
   (cf. [[mw:Snippets/Horizontal lists]]). */
.liste-horizontale ul,
.liste-horizontale ol,
.liste-horizontale li {
	margin-left: 0;
	display: inline;
	white-space: nowrap;
}
.liste-horizontale li:after {
	content: " "; /* au cas ou Mediawiki supprime les retours ligne */
}
.liste-horizontale li + li:before {
	white-space: normal;
	content: "· ";
	font-weight: bold;
}
.liste-horizontale li li:first-child:before {
	white-space: normal;
	content: " (";
}
.liste-horizontale li ul:after,
.liste-horizontale li ol:after{
	content: ")";
	margin-left: -0.28em;
}
.liste-horizontale ol {
	counter-reset: listitem;
}
.liste-horizontale ol > li {
	counter-increment: listitem;
}
.liste-horizontale ol > li:first-child:before {
	content: "1.\202F";
}
.liste-horizontale li ol > li:first-child:before {
	content: " (1.\202F";
}
.liste-horizontale ol > li + li:before {
	content: "· " counter(listitem) ".\202F";
	font-weight: normal;
}
/* Listes sans puces */
.liste-simple ul {
	line-height: inherit;
	list-style: none none;
	margin: 0;
}
.liste-simple ul li {
	margin-bottom: 0;
}

.phoneinfo
{
    color: red;
    background: yellow;
    display: inline !important;
}
/* Classe pour les listes horizontales séparées par des puces.
   Adaptation de la classe 'hlist' de en:User:Edokter.
   (cf. [[mw:Snippets/Horizontal lists]]). */
.liste-horizontale ul,
.liste-horizontale li {
	margin-left: 0;
	display: inline;
	white-space: nowrap;
	*white-space: normal; /* be kind ie7 */
}
.liste-horizontale ul:after { /* be kind firefox (38) : cas ou le dernier élément est une sous-liste avec un seul élément */
	white-space: normal;
}
.liste-horizontale li:after {
	content: " "; /* au cas ou Mediawiki supprime les retours ligne */
}
.liste-horizontale li + li:before {
	white-space: normal;
	content: "· ";
	font-weight: bold;
}
.liste-horizontale li li:first-child:before {
	white-space: normal;
	content: " (";
}
.liste-horizontale li ul:after {
	content: ")";
	margin-left: -0.28em;
}

/* Listes sans puces */
.liste-simple ul {
	line-height: inherit;
	list-style: none none;
	margin: 0;
}
.liste-simple ul li {
	margin-bottom: 0;
}

/* Classes pour les colonnes des portails */
.portail-gauche {
	float: left;
}
.portail-droite {
	float: right;
}
@media screen and (max-width: 65em) {
	.portail-gauche,
	.portail-droite {
		float: none;
		width: auto !important;
	}
}

#accueil-ligne {
    border-top:1px solid #EEE;
    color:#C9C9C9;
    margin-top:10px;
    padding:0px 20px;
}